Checkout Google Colab. Download PyCharm community. Download python at python.org and explore the site.
For resources the university of Helsinki (MOOC) has a great text-based course covers quite a lot, the book "Automate the Boring Stuff" is great and my Python and Data Science starts from scratch and assumes no background.
I think these resources should be more than enough. Code as much as you can and get into the habit of looking things up at python.org
